He already proved it at the state championships in October, but this was just further validation.

Fort Collins High School boys cross-country standout Christian Groendyk was named Gatorade's Colorado boys cross-country Runner of the Year on Monday.

It was a well-earned honor for the Lambkins senior.

Groendyk posted an unbeaten cross-country season last fall, including wins at the Liberty Bell (in a school-record 14 minutes, 48 seconds), the prestigious Desert Twilight Festival in Arizona and the Colorado Class 5A state championship.

"When all was said and done, Christian Groendyk’s legs authored one of the greatest seasons in Colorado history,” PrepCalTrack editor Rich Gonzalez said in a news release.

That followed a summer where he also won the local FireKracker 5K race in Fort Collins.

The yearly award sponsored by Gatorade recognizes the best athletes by sport in every state. It honors not only outstanding athletic excellence, but also high standards of academic achievement and exemplary character demonstrated on and off the field or track.

Groendyk has a weighted GPA of 4.10, volunteered locally with the Food Bank for Larimer County plus Fort Collins Recreation and will attend Princeton next fall to extend his cross-country and track career.

He is now a finalist for the Gatorade National boys Cross Country Runner of the Year, which will be announced in February.

Groendyk is the first runner from Fort Collins to win the award and the second athlete in two seasons from the area to earn a Gatorade honor.

Fossil Ridge's Nikki McGaffin was the 2021-22 Gatorade Colorado girls softball Player of the Year.
